Как включить вызовы JSON в моем приложении ASP.NET MVC 2? - PullRequest
3 голосов
/ 15 декабря 2010

Я пытаюсь создать динамическую диаграмму, используя HighCharts, но, как кажется, невозможно включить ASP-теги в JavaScript, поэтому я пытаюсь использовать JSon.Я следовал этому учебнику шаг за шагом, но когда я пытаюсь загрузить страницу, я получаю следующее сообщение:

Этот запрос был заблокирован, поскольку конфиденциальная информация могла бытьраскрывается сторонним веб-сайтам, когда это используется в запросе GET.Чтобы разрешить запросы GET, установите для JsonRequestBehavior значение AllowGet.

Так что теперь мне интересно, нужно ли мне что-то устанавливать в Web.Config или где-то еще.

Не могли бы вы, ребята, помочь мне

1 Ответ

6 голосов
/ 15 декабря 2010

Есть довольно простое исправление.В ваших функциях обработки запросов, где у вас будет:

return Json(myStuff);

Замените его на перегрузку, которая принимает JsonRequestBehavior:

return Json(myStuff, JsonRequestBehavior.AllowGet);
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...